Kaneda, when you buy a new Kia you get the 10 year 100,000 mile warranty on the powertrain. When you buy a used Kia, your warranty ends when the car reaches 5 years old or 60,000 miles, whichever comes first. The age of the car goes back to when it was first purchased by the original owner. So if it was bought the first time one year ago, then you have 4 years remaining. To keep the warranty in force, you must be able to demonstrate that you have followed the recommended service schedule. You can have your car serviced at any "authorized" service provider -- you don't have to have it serviced where you bought it. Keep your receipts to prove that you had it serviced. Follow the service schedule in the manual.
